/** * Load Ranking * * @param string Ranking String * @param integer Ranking Limit * @return void */ private function loadRanking($ranking, $limit) { require_once THIS_APPLICATION_PATH . "modules/rankings/ranking.php"; $showRanking = new Rankings_Ranking(); $showRanking->registry(); $showRanking->initSection($ranking, $limit); }
/** * Init Module * * @return void */ public function init() { $this->lang->loadLanguageFile("rankings"); if (!empty($_GET['load'])) { $this->setRankings(); if (!in_array($_GET['load'], $this->rankings)) { exit("<div class=\"error-box\">" . $this->lang->words['Rankings']['LoadRank']['Messages']['InvalidRank'] . "</div>"); } elseif ($this->loadCheckEnableRanking($_GET['load']) == false) { exit("<div class=\"error-box\">" . $this->lang->words['Rankings']['LoadRank']['Messages']['Disabled'] . "</div>"); } require_once THIS_APPLICATION_PATH . "modules/rankings/ranking.php"; $showRanking = new Rankings_Ranking(); $showRanking->registry(); $showRanking->initSection($_GET['load'], $this->settings['RANKING'][$this->_settings[array_search($_GET['load'], $this->rankings)]][1]); } else { require_once THIS_APPLICATION_PATH . "modules/rankings/generator.php"; $rankGenerator = new Rankings_Generator(); $rankGenerator->registry(); $rankGenerator->setRankings(); $rankGenerator->initSection(); } }